感謝整理
入門(mén)HBase坎弯,看這一篇就夠了團(tuán)隊(duì)內(nèi)部要分享HBase的知識(shí)甸箱,之前研究了一段時(shí)間伶棒,知識(shí)比較零散担钮,這一次就系統(tǒng)化的整理一番压语,之后在想到Hbase的時(shí)候格仲,看著一篇就夠了吱晒。 阿里陶系技術(shù)部招人财著,目前大把機(jī)會(huì)联四,H...
感謝整理
入門(mén)HBase坎弯,看這一篇就夠了團(tuán)隊(duì)內(nèi)部要分享HBase的知識(shí)甸箱,之前研究了一段時(shí)間伶棒,知識(shí)比較零散担钮,這一次就系統(tǒng)化的整理一番压语,之后在想到Hbase的時(shí)候格仲,看著一篇就夠了吱晒。 阿里陶系技術(shù)部招人财著,目前大把機(jī)會(huì)联四,H...
團(tuán)隊(duì)內(nèi)部要分享HBase的知識(shí)撑教,之前研究了一段時(shí)間朝墩,知識(shí)比較零散,這一次就系統(tǒng)化的整理一番,之后在想到Hbase的時(shí)候收苏,看著一篇就夠了亿卤。 阿里陶系技術(shù)部招人,目前大把機(jī)會(huì)鹿霸,H...
為什么叫x86和x86_64和AMD64? 為什么大家叫x86為32位系統(tǒng)懦鼠? 為什么軟件版本會(huì)注明 for amd64版本钻哩,不是intel64呢? x86是指intel的開(kāi)發(fā)...
哈哈謝謝
JAVA IO專(zhuān)題二:java NIO讀取文件并通過(guò)socket發(fā)送肛冶,最少拷貝了幾次街氢?堆外內(nèi)存和所謂的零拷貝到底是什么關(guān)系相關(guān)IO專(zhuān)題 JAVA IO專(zhuān)題一:java InputStream和OutputStream讀取文件并通過(guò)socket發(fā)送,到底涉及幾次拷貝[https://www.jia...
我們知道Flink提供了容錯(cuò)機(jī)制睦袖,能夠在應(yīng)用失敗的時(shí)候重新恢復(fù)任務(wù)珊肃。這個(gè)機(jī)制主要就是通過(guò)持續(xù)產(chǎn)生快照的方式實(shí)現(xiàn)的。Flink快照主要包括兩部分?jǐn)?shù)據(jù)一部分是數(shù)據(jù)流的數(shù)據(jù)馅笙,另一部...
關(guān)于問(wèn)題:hashMap的紅黑樹(shù)不一定小于6的時(shí)候才會(huì)轉(zhuǎn)換為鏈表伦乔,而是只有在resize的時(shí)候才會(huì)根據(jù) UNTREEIFY_THRESHOLD 進(jìn)行轉(zhuǎn)換。
我的猜測(cè)是:
resize會(huì)將容量擴(kuò)大成之前的二倍董习,此時(shí)一個(gè)鏈表被拆分成多個(gè)烈和,當(dāng)前這個(gè)鏈表因?yàn)椴鸱侄兌痰某潭?在概率上 要大于 單純的remove操作引起的變短,也就是說(shuō)resize來(lái)做 “紅黑樹(shù)”-> "鏈表"的轉(zhuǎn)化更合適
原文作者: 逍遙絕情原文地址:原文鏈接摘抄申明:我們不占有不侵權(quán)斥杜,我們只是好文的搬運(yùn)工!轉(zhuǎn)發(fā)請(qǐng)帶上原文申明沥匈。 TinkerPop Gremlin基礎(chǔ)概念 圖計(jì)算在結(jié)構(gòu)(圖)和...
是的 建表語(yǔ)句寫(xiě)串了蔗喂,已經(jīng)改了
mysql死鎖場(chǎng)景整理簡(jiǎn)述 本文死鎖場(chǎng)景皆為工作中遇到(或同事遇到)并解決的死鎖場(chǎng)景,寫(xiě)這篇文章的目的是整理和分享高帖,歡迎指正和補(bǔ)充诱篷,本文死鎖場(chǎng)景包括: 行鎖導(dǎo)致死鎖 gap lock/next k...
前言 這是前段時(shí)間我在公司內(nèi)部Android組的技術(shù)分享會(huì)上茉兰,以響應(yīng)式編程為主題做的一個(gè)專(zhuān)題分享掌测,反饋還不錯(cuò)旅择,但是也有很多問(wèn)題,因此我根據(jù)反饋重新修改和完善了相關(guān)的論述预麸,組成...
講“信號(hào)量模式并非是一個(gè)好的選擇”的例子瞪浸,感覺(jué)并不恰當(dāng)吧。用線(xiàn)程池模式吏祸,也會(huì)有這樣的問(wèn)題啊对蒲。因?yàn)橐粋€(gè)接口調(diào)取三個(gè)服務(wù)時(shí),線(xiàn)程模式下雖然是異步調(diào)用,但還是會(huì)一一等待獲取結(jié)果的蹈矮,這樣總耗時(shí)還是3個(gè)服務(wù)的調(diào)用之和砰逻。
nolan4954 評(píng)論自Hystrix系列之信號(hào)量、線(xiàn)程池
沒(méi)太明白actor具體優(yōu)勢(shì)是什么泛鸟。蝠咆。如果按最后的兩個(gè)例子來(lái)說(shuō),用隊(duì)列緩存消息等待發(fā)送北滥,跟多線(xiàn)程阻塞的方式有什么區(qū)別嗎
Actor模型傳統(tǒng)的游戲服務(wù)器要么是單線(xiàn)程要么是多線(xiàn)程刚操,過(guò)去幾十年里CPU一直遵循摩爾定律發(fā)展,帶來(lái)的結(jié)果是單核頻率越來(lái)越高碑韵。而近幾年摩爾定義在CPU上已然失效赡茸,為什么呢缎脾? 大于在2003...
2020.3好像沒(méi)彈鏈接
獲得Intellija Idea 40%折扣的方法填寫(xiě)一個(gè)被屏蔽掉的服務(wù)器地址 點(diǎn)擊激活后祝闻,idea會(huì)提示如下錯(cuò)誤,點(diǎn)擊這里 調(diào)轉(zhuǎn)到idea的購(gòu)買(mǎi)網(wǎng)站上去
好久遗菠,好久....沒(méi)有更博客了联喘。這一次利用閑暇時(shí)間,來(lái)扯一下關(guān)于JVM中的TLAB辙纬。什么是TLAB豁遭?它是干什么的?咋們先拋開(kāi)這個(gè)問(wèn)題贺拣,一切的開(kāi)始得從new對(duì)象到指針碰撞開(kāi)始講...
xxljob并不是基于quartz的誒
Quartz設(shè)計(jì)原理詳解(多圖)定時(shí)任務(wù)是日常開(kāi)發(fā)中非常常見(jiàn)的功能蓖谢。 對(duì)于簡(jiǎn)單的任務(wù)處理Spring的@Scheduled非常好用。如果處理更復(fù)雜的情況譬涡,比如需要宕機(jī)恢復(fù)或者集群調(diào)度闪幽,那么Quartz是個(gè)不...
簡(jiǎn)述 本文死鎖場(chǎng)景皆為工作中遇到(或同事遇到)并解決的死鎖場(chǎng)景,寫(xiě)這篇文章的目的是整理和分享涡匀,歡迎指正和補(bǔ)充盯腌,本文死鎖場(chǎng)景包括: 行鎖導(dǎo)致死鎖 gap lock/next k...
其他相關(guān)專(zhuān)題 JAVA IO專(zhuān)題一:java InputStream和OutputStream讀取文件并通過(guò)socket發(fā)送,到底涉及幾次拷貝[https://www.jia...
相關(guān)java IO專(zhuān)題 JAVA IO專(zhuān)題一:java InputStream和OutputStream讀取文件并通過(guò)socket發(fā)送陨瘩,到底涉及幾次拷貝[https://ww...
相關(guān)IO專(zhuān)題 JAVA IO專(zhuān)題一:java InputStream和OutputStream讀取文件并通過(guò)socket發(fā)送舌劳,到底涉及幾次拷貝[https://www.jia...
面向流和面向緩沖區(qū)還是不太明白
> JavaIO面向流意味著每次從流中讀一個(gè)或多個(gè)字節(jié)帚湘,直至讀取所有字節(jié),它們沒(méi)有被緩存在任何地方甚淡。
socketInputStream把socket的數(shù)據(jù)拷貝到堆內(nèi)的byte數(shù)組中大诸,按我理解這個(gè)就是一個(gè)緩存的過(guò)程啊
> Java NIO的緩沖讀取方法略有不同。數(shù)據(jù)讀取到一個(gè)緩沖區(qū),需要時(shí)可在緩沖區(qū)中前后移動(dòng)
所以這里所說(shuō)的緩沖區(qū)底挫,是指堆外的緩沖區(qū)嗎恒傻?
徹底搞懂NIO效率高的原理前言 這篇文章讀不懂的沒(méi)關(guān)系,可以先收藏一下建邓。筆者準(zhǔn)備介紹完epoll和NIO等知識(shí)點(diǎn)盈厘,然后寫(xiě)一篇Java網(wǎng)絡(luò)IO模型的介紹,這樣可以使Java網(wǎng)絡(luò)IO的知識(shí)體系更加地完整和...